5. Guardian Ape - Sekiro: Shadows Die Twice

Although Sekiro: Shadows Die Twice put a refreshing spin on the Soulsborne formula by giving players a grappling hook alongside putting an emphasis on stealth and deflecting attacks, this game was still full of FromSoftware’s notoriously difficult boss fights.

One of these fiendish foes is The Guadian Ape, who serves as the final boss at the end of the Sunken Valley Package.

A gigantic primate, this boss hits with devastating force and moves with great speed.  After learning their attacks, players will soon succeed in taking this boss down, decapitating it with the sword embedded in their neck.

With the words “Shinobi Execution” displayed onscreen, players will feel victorious in their accomplishment. But this feeling is short-lived.

In a cruel trick from the developers, this boss has a surprise second phase. Picking up both its severed head and sword, the Guardian Ape is even more difficult than before. Not only does it now have an arsenal of powerful sword attacks, but its head now emits a blood-curdling scream that inflicts a massive amount of terror damage.

Reaching its climax when severing a grotesque centipede that the titular shinobi pulls from inside the ape’s body, this is an exhilarating fight that players won’t soon forget.
